The Medical Assistant I is responsible for adhering to the Medical Assistant scope of practice, following all policies and procedures, and maintaining training and competency based on area of specialty when providing patient care. This role involves performing rooming/visit tasks such as vital signs, medication reconciliation, medical history, health maintenance, allergy review, and screenings. The Medical Assistant will also assist providers with procedures, perform lab-related duties including venipuncture and specimen collection, administer medications and vaccines safely, and handle various administrative tasks such as medication refills, insurance authorizations, and patient messaging. Cross-training for duties relevant to the clinic practice is expected. The position requires effective communication, teamwork, and maintaining a clean work environment with stocked supplies and functional equipment. The Medical Assistant must demonstrate knowledge and skills appropriate for the age of the patients served, understanding principles of growth and development.
